Market Context

Empire has recently seen notable upward momentum, with shares gaining over 8% in the latest session to trade near $2.83. The move comes on above-average volume, suggesting increased investor interest after a period of consolidation above the support level around $2.69. Resistance at $2.97 remains a key level to watch; a sustained push toward that area would likely require continued buying pressure. In the broader sector context, energy and commodities-related names have been experiencing mixed sentiment amid shifting macroeconomic expectations. Empire appears to be benefiting from a rotation into value-oriented plays, as market participants weigh potential changes in interest rate policy and commodity demand. The stock's recent activity aligns with a pattern of higher lows over recent weeks, which may indicate building support. Volume patterns have been erratic in prior months, but the latest surge—accompanied by the price breakout—could reflect a shift in short-term sentiment. While no specific catalyst has been confirmed, the move appears partly driven by positioning ahead of upcoming sector-wide data releases. The stock's current price action suggests that traders are watching for a potential test of the resistance zone, though broader market conditions remain a variable. Overall, Empire's recent trading reflects cautious optimism, with the stock attempting to establish a stronger footing within its recent range. Technical Analysis

Empire (EP) currently trades at $2.83, hovering in a narrow range defined by well-established technical levels. The stock has found consistent buying interest near the $2.69 support zone, which has held firm in recent sessions. This level coincides with a previous consolidation area, suggesting a strong floor. On the upside, resistance sits at $2.97, a level that has capped rallies over the past several weeks. A decisive move above this threshold would likely signal a shift in the short-term trend, but until that occurs, the price remains range-bound. Price action patterns indicate a period of consolidation following a prior downtrend. The stock has formed a series of higher lows since testing the support zone, potentially building a base. Volume has been relatively subdued during this sideways movement, which may suggest a lack of strong directional conviction from traders. Looking at momentum indicators, the relative strength index (RSI) is positioned in the mid-range, neither overbought nor oversold, leaving room for movement in either direction. The moving average convergence divergence (MACD) line appears to be flattening near its signal line, hinting at a possible shift in momentum. Traders will be watching for a breakout above $2.97 or a breakdown below $2.69 to confirm the next significant move. Until then, the stock may continue to oscillate within these boundaries. Outlook

The recent 8.62% surge has pushed Empire shares into a zone of indecision between established support at $2.69 and resistance at $2.97. The price action above the support level suggests near-term momentum may remain constructive, but the stock now approaches a test of overhead supply. A decisive move above $2.97 on above-average volume could open the door toward higher territory, though such a breakout would likely require a catalyst—perhaps sector-wide interest or operational updates. Conversely, a failure to clear resistance or a pullback toward $2.69 could indicate lingering caution. Should the stock slip below this support, a retest of lower levels might follow. Broader market conditions, interest rate expectations, and company-specific developments, such as cash flow trends or project updates, may influence which path emerges. Volume patterns in the coming sessions will offer clues: sustained buying pressure would support further gains, while declining volume near resistance would suggest the move lacks conviction. Traders are watching these key levels closely for the next directional signal.
